The invention relates to the technical field of electric automobiles, in particular to an automobile with a battery airtightness detection function and a battery airtightness detection method, and the automobile with the battery airtightness detection function comprises a battery pack, an inflation part, a pressure maintaining part, a detection part and a control part. The battery pack is provided with an anti-explosion valve, the pressure maintaining part and the anti-explosion valve are oppositely arranged, the inflation part, the pressure maintaining part and the detection part are all in communication connection with the control part, and the inflation part is communicated with the battery pack. When the control part triggers a detection instruction, the pressure maintaining part can apply pressure for pressing the explosion-proof valve into the battery pack, the inflation part can inflate the battery pack, and the detection part can feed back the real-time pressure of the battery pack to the control part. According to the automobile with the battery airtightness detection function and the battery airtightness detection method, the automobile can detect the airtightness of the battery pack in real time, the procedure that the battery pack needs to be disassembled and assembled in the airtightness detection process is avoided, and the airtightness detection convenience and operability of the battery pack are improved.
